How the Mobile Notary Process Works
Schedule an Appointment
Ensure Your Forms Are Complete
Provide a Valid Photo ID
Sign the Document in the Notary’s Presence
Official Stamp and Seal Applied
Everything You Need to Know About Notarization
1. How much does a mobile notary service cost in Tulsa?
Mobile notary services generally start at $50, with additional costs for urgent requests.
2. Can a mobile notary come to my home or office?
Yes! Our mobile notaries travel to homes, offices, hospitals, hotels, and other locations.
3. What types of identification are accepted for notarization?
Expired IDs are not accepted—ensure your identification is current.
4. Do you offer online notarization in Tulsa?
Yes! Remote online notarization allows you to notarize documents via video conferencing.
5. What happens if my document is incomplete?
All fields should be completed before the notarization process, except for the signature.
